Improvements in Methods for Measuring the Parameters of Harmonic Signals Based on Spatially Separated Instantaneous Values

Methods for measuring the parameters of harmonic signals based on individual instantaneous values separated in space are examined. The proposed methods ensure a substantial reduction in the measurement time, the duration of which is independent of the time the measurement starts, the duration of the input signal period, and the phase shift between the voltage and current.
